Gloucestershire Health and Care is committed to embedding and providing personalised care through all of its services as part of our high-quality care strategy. The purpose of personalised care is to empower people to lead the lives they want to live. Personalised care starts with a conversation with people about what matters to them. It builds on what people can do, as well as addressing their health needs.
We are including new ways of working and delivering care, emphasising the need to make effective use of the full range of our people's skills and experience to deliver the best possible patient care. We want to know What Matters to You and hope that you will share our values and join us on this very important journey.

Understand the Role: Read the job description and person specification carefully. Make sure you understand the qualifications, training, and experience required for the Apprentice Administrator position at Gloucestershire Health and Care.
Tailor Your CV: Customise your CV to highlight relevant skills and experiences that align with the values of personalised care. Emphasise any previous administrative experience or customer service roles that demonstrate your ability to support patient care.
Craft a Compelling Cover Letter: Write a cover letter that reflects your passion for personalised care and how your values align with those of Gloucestershire Health and Care. Share specific examples of how you have empowered others or contributed to a team in previous roles.
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, thoroughly proofread your application materials. Check for spelling and grammatical errors, and ensure that all information is clear and concise. A polished application shows attention to detail and professionalism.
